Transaction 98080f3f92088e1e5b6fe6825815bd778a9f7d3c5824fa3362ca9748fae0b3d3

50 Input
2 Outputs
  • 98080f3f92088e1e5b6fe6825815bd778a9f7d3c5824fa3362ca9748fae0b3d3:0
  • value  15980000
    address  1894tvZEHNk6KdGsojh2m1UUrsbg1q3Peg
  • 98080f3f92088e1e5b6fe6825815bd778a9f7d3c5824fa3362ca9748fae0b3d3:1
  • value  15572006
    address  3FJfzgKvu8XLN9pvP2AnVvoUeayvyeDGLr